Peterhead Academy is a six-year Comprehensive Community School in Peterhead, Aberdeenshire, Scotland. It is operated by Aberdeenshire Council.
The original building of Peterhead academy Was built in 1846 and was originally a boys only school The South-east wing was built in 1961 with further building in the 1970s taking the school to its current form. The extension to the school is formed of several hexagonal sections and contains the school's swimming pool. It was opened by Fraser Noble in 1978. The newer area of the academy that is connected to the peterhead leisure centre used to be Peterhead's very own train station.
